AL Central: Can Thomas slide back into full-time role?

Cleveland Guardians

Following the deadline acquisition of Lane Thomas (OF, CLE), Will Brennan (OF, CLE) was sent down to Triple-A. But after going 13-for-31 with a homer and 4 SB, he was brought back up to the big league club on August 9, where he has since started five-of-six games vs. right-handed starters.

Jhonkensy Noel (OF, CLE) has primarily served as a short-side platoon bat but could be taking on a larger role, which combined with the return of Brennan, creates quite the logjam. The 23-year-old recently sat seven straight games against a right-handed starter but has since started three of the last four against them.
